My TAP shift will not upshift automatically in M, it will ride the rev limiter until I hit the button. It will downshift automatically but not upshift. I use mine every day because I drive a curvy mountain road and I can downshift before getting on the throttle which really helps launch out of the curves. It also keeps me from constantly shifting in and out of 4th and TCC lock like it does in D. There are hills that I know I will downshift on and with the TAP I can DS before I even start without taking my hands off the wheel. I can see where in most driving situations TAP would be completely useless but where I drive it is wonderful. Mine is not slow, maybe because of my PCM Tune, I dunno. Also, something worth noting, I get 3 more MPG making my drive to work in M than I do in D, and I tend to drive it harder in M.
